Live Betting: How it works
Believe it or not, there was a time where sports betting consisted of pre-match wagers only. The introduction of live betting has allowed bettors new ways to wager on sport and bet on the games as they watch them.
An example of a live, or in-play bet, is as follows:
Novak Djokovic is playing Rafael Nadal at Wimbledon. On the moneyline, Djokovic is favorite to win the match, at -100 odds.
Despite being the favorite, Djokovic loses the first set, and is 3-0 down in the second. The live odds for Djokovic to win this game are at +150. If you are watching the game, you would know that Djokovic is playing well, and you may be confident that he will overcome the deficit and win the match.
If you place a bet now on Djokovic to win the match, you would get $250 returns from a $100 stake, rather than $200 returns from a $100 stake pre match.
Djokovic wins the second set, despite being 3-0 down, and the odds begin to drop. After winning the third set, Djokovic’s odds of winning the match have returned to -200.
Djokovic completes his comeback and wins the match. Bettors who had wagered on Djokovic to win pre-match at odds of -200, would have won $50 less than bettors who backed him in-play.
This example shows how odds fluctuate during the event, and how you are able to take advantage for a profit.

Live Betting Sites Features Explained
Live Streaming
One of the best features to come with online sports betting, live streaming allows you to watch the games you’re betting on, bringing you closer to the action.
While in-game statistics and live tracking are useful, there’s no substitute for actually seeing the action before placing that all-important live bet.
Usually indicated by a play button icon, the list of sports events you can stream depends on the operator you choose. On the whole, though, you can expect to find a good range of live streaming options at the majority of US betting sites.
It is worth noting that although you won’t need to pay extra to live stream events, your sportsbook account must have funds in it, or you need to have placed a bet in the 24 hours prior to streaming an event. Each sportsbook will have different rules, so it’s worth checking out what the requirements are.
Live Tracking
The second best feature to live streaming, live tracking is a nice feature which gives a visual representation of what is happening in the event. In soccer, there may be a graphic of a soccer pitch, with a detailed view of where the ball is on the pitch, and which team has the ball.
The best live betting sites will have the most advanced software, meaning their live tracking will enable you to see which players are involved in the action the most, helping you to decide the scorer of the next touchdown, goal, or basket. A great feature, and one that will be offered at the best in-play betting sites.
In Game Stats
A critical element when wagering on sports, statistics can provide important details to help you place your bets. Live statistics give bettors an overview of the action and is a useful feature if you’re not watching the action live.
From looking at stats, you can get a good measure of how teams and players are performing, helping you to make more informed live bets in the process.
For example, in soccer, a team with a high number of shots on target or a high corner count may mean they are more likely to score the next goal. Alternatively, a player who has made a large number of fouls is more likely to be yellow carded.
Cash Out
Cash out is a fantastic feature unique to online sports betting, and allows you to end your wager instantly and perhaps make a profit before the event has finished. The value of your cashout will depend upon the status of the live event.
For example, if you have backed the Brooklyn Nets moneyline and they are up by 10 in the fourth quarter, you will likely be offered a sum close to the payout of your bet. If you were not confident Brooklyn would go on to win the game, you could cash out for a profit before the game finishes.
It’s worth noting that there are different variations to the cash-out feature. BetMGM and PointsBet both offer a feature known as Partial Cash Out. Here you can choose to cash out part of your bet and still leave some money on the original wager.
Automatic Cash-Out, known as Auto Cash-Out, sees wagers cashed out automatically once they’ve hit a certain figure decided by you. This saves those moments of dread when your huge bet value diminishes, when in hindsight, you would have settled for that amount.

What are the benefits of live betting?
While there is always risk involved in any form of betting, there can be many benefits to live or in-play betting.
Increased Odds
One of the biggest advantages of in-play betting is the increased odds of an event occurring. For example, Ja’Marr Chase may have been -150 pre-game to score a touchdown anytime during a Cincinatti Bengals game. However, at half time, with Chase yet to score a touchdown, these odds of an anytime touchdown may be increased to +100 or better, giving you a chance to cash in on some nicer looking odds.
Live Streaming
One of the main advantages of live betting is that you may well be watching the action unfold in front of your eyes. This means you have a much better idea of what is most likely to happen next in the game. In case of pre-match betting, you are basing your wagers off of statistics and previous form.
Speed of odds change
The popularity of in-play bets is also caused by the fact that not all sportsbooks quickly manage to change the odds for a certain outcome after some changes in the event.
For example, if you are watching a match and the scoreline changes, It is logical that the sportsbook will quickly change the odds. However, this doesn’t always happen immediately, and you will have a chance to bet on the odds that haven’t changed yet.
Laying your bet
Live betting can sometimes allow you to guarantee some profit from a game, if you have placed a wager pre game. Let’s say you have backed the Knicks moneyline at +200 against the Nets pre-game. With a $100 wager, you’re set to return $300 from your initial stake.
If the Knicks run up a tasty lead in the first quarter, the odds of the Nets winning the game would increase. If these odds increased to +200, you could place an additional $100 on the Nets in play. You now have two bets on each outcome, meaning that no matter the outcome of the game, you would be guaranteed a profit of $100.
These cases are tough to come by, but are certainly worth looking out for, as it’s a great way of guaranteeing some profit, despite the winnings not always being as generous as you may please.
Live Betting Sites FAQs
What is live betting?
Live betting is a type of wagering where you place your bets once a game or match has already started. Live betting can also be known as in-play betting.
What sports can I bet on at live betting sites?
All of the major sports will have live betting markets available. Football, basketball, soccer and tennis are among the most popular of sports, and will be regularly featured at the best online betting sites.
The best in-play betting sites will offer markets on smaller sports, such as table tennis and squash.
How do I find the live betting section?
The live betting section will be easily accessible on the sportsbook website. Each live section will be located differently on each sportsbook, but will be easily highlighted. Some sportsbooks may refer to their live betting section as ‘in-play’.
Are in-play and live betting the same thing?
Yes, in-play and live betting are exactly the same concept. The term regarding live betting may differ for each sportsbook, but both mean the same form of betting.
